今年夏天,我厂一位职工发现家里的日光灯关灯后灯管两端仍有微光,用手触摸灯管外壁微光增强。经检查,拉线开关控制的是零线。为了省事,他把配电盘闸刀开关下的相线与零线对调,上述现象排除了。可是过了一会儿,隔壁邻居在移动落地电扇时,突然触电倒地,幸好电扇倒向了另一侧,使触电者脱离了电源,才未发生死亡事故。后来一检查,该电扇的保护零线在调线后成了相线,使电扇外壳带电。
